515060611051 has 32 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 644369375232. Its totient is φ = 401484142080.
The previous prime is 515060611049. The next prime is 515060611067. The reversal of 515060611051 is 150116060515.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 515060611051 - 21 = 515060611049 is a prime.
It is a Harshad number since it is a multiple of its sum of digits (31).
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(515060611151) by changing a digit.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(23)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 31 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 2278885 + ... + 2494681.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(20136542976).
Almost surely, 2515060611051 is an apocalyptic number.
515060611051 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(129308764181).
515060611051 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
515060611051 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The sum of its prime factors is 216499.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 4500, while the sum is 31.
Adding to 515060611051 its reverse (150116060515), we get a palindrome (665176671566).
